Infrastructure and Road Conditions

One significant factor contributing to bicycle accidents in Silver Spring is the state of our infrastructure and road conditions. Despite efforts to improve cycling paths and designate bike lanes, many areas still lack adequate facilities for cyclists. This deficiency forces bicyclists onto roads shared with motor vehicles, increasing the risk of collisions. Furthermore, potholes, uneven surfaces, and poorly maintained roads can lead to loss of control for cyclists, resulting in accidents. Visibility Issues

Another critical cause of bicycle accidents is visibility. Many accidents occur during dawn, dusk, or nighttime when visibility is reduced. Cyclists, being smaller and less visible compared to cars and trucks, often go unnoticed until it’s too late. Lack of proper lighting on bicycles, inadequate reflective gear, and drivers’ failure to pay attention to their surroundings contribute to these visibility issues. Head Injuries

One of the most severe and common injuries sustained in bicycle accidents are head injuries, including concussions and traumatic brain injuries (TBIs). These injuries can result from a cyclist’s head striking the ground, a vehicle, or another object during an accident. The repercussions of head injuries can be profound, affecting cognitive function, physical abilities, and emotional well-being. Despite the effectiveness of helmets in reducing the risk of head injuries, they are not always worn, nor do they completely eliminate the risk. Understanding Negligence

Negligence is defined as the failure to exercise the care that a reasonably prudent person would exercise in similar circumstances. This concept hinges on the premise that individuals owe a duty of care to avoid causing harm to others. In the context of bicycle accidents, negligence may manifest through various actions or omissions by motorists, cyclists, or even municipalities responsible for road maintenance.

The Four Elements of Negligence

Proving negligence requires demonstrating four key elements: duty, breach, causation, and damages. Our approach at Azari Law, LLC, meticulously addresses each of these components:

  • Duty of Care: Establishing that the defendant owed a duty of care to the plaintiff. For cyclists, this often means proving that a motorist or other entity had an obligation to act in a manner that prevents harm. This duty varies depending on the relationship between the parties and the situation.
  • Breach of Duty: Demonstrating that the defendant breached that duty through action or inaction. In bicycle accident cases, this could involve showing that a motorist was driving recklessly, a municipality failed to maintain safe road conditions, or a cyclist was not following traffic laws.
  • Causation: Linking the breach of duty directly to the accident and the plaintiff’s injuries. It must be shown that but for the defendant’s breach of duty, the plaintiff would not have been injured. This often requires detailed evidence and sometimes expert testimony.
  • Damages: Proving that the plaintiff suffered actual losses or harm as a result of the accident. This can include medical bills, lost wages, pain and suffering, and other forms of compensatory damages.

Gathering Evidence

To build a convincing case, collecting comprehensive evidence is crucial. Our strategy encompasses:

  • Accident Reports: Including police reports and incident documentation that provide an official account of the accident.
  • Witness Statements: Testimonies from individuals who witnessed the accident can corroborate the plaintiff’s account of events.
  • Medical Records: Documenting injuries and treatment to establish the extent of damages suffered.
  • Expert Testimony: Specialists in fields like accident reconstruction or medical professionals can provide insights that support the causation between the breach of duty and the injuries incurred.
  • Photographic and Video Evidence: Images and footage of the accident scene, injuries, and property damage offer visual proof of the claims.

Types of Compensation Available

Bicycle accident compensation encompasses several categories of damages, each designed to address different aspects of the victim’s losses and suffering. Our aim is to ensure clients are fully aware of their entitlements, which include:

  • Medical Expenses: Compensation for current and future medical bills resulting from the accident, including emergency room visits, hospitalization, surgery, medication, rehabilitation, and any necessary medical equipment.
  • Lost Wages and Earning Capacity: This includes compensation for income lost due to the inability to work in the aftermath of the accident and potential future losses if the victim’s earning capacity is affected long-term.
  • Pain and Suffering: Non-economic damages that compensate for the physical pain and emotional distress endured by the victim as a result of the accident. This also encompasses loss of enjoyment of life.
  • Property Damage: Reimbursement for the repair or replacement of the bicycle and any other personal property damaged during the accident.
  • Punitive Damages: In cases where the defendant’s conduct is found to be especially egregious or reckless, punitive damages may be awarded as a form of punishment and deterrence.

You May Be More Hurt Than You Realize

An automobile not only has safety features, such as seatbelts and airbags, to protect its occupants, it also has a metal frame that often absorbs a lot of the impact from a crash. Your bicycle has a metal frame too, but it does not surround you, and there are no airbags or seat belts. You are much more exposed on your bicycle, which translates to a greater chance of serious injury. 

Symptoms of serious injury do not always show up right away. They can take time to develop, as in the case of internal bleeding. Symptoms may also be masked by the adrenaline released by your body during the crash, which can take several hours to wear off. Following an accident, it is a good idea to have a medical evaluation right away to identify any serious injuries. 

Treatment is often more effective if it takes place as soon as possible after the injury. Therefore, the sooner an injury is identified following a crash, the better your chances of full recovery.

Frequently Asked Questions About Bicycle Accident In Silver Spring

What are the key bicycle laws in Silver Spring, MD that could affect my accident claim?

In Silver Spring, MD, bicyclists are subject to many of the same rules and regulations as motor vehicle drivers, which includes obeying all traffic signals and signs, riding with the flow of traffic, and using designated bicycle lanes where available. Maryland law also requires all cyclists under the age of 16 to wear a helmet. These laws play a critical role in accident claims, as failure to adhere to them can impact fault and liability. For instance, if a cyclist was riding against traffic or not using proper lights at night, this could potentially reduce the compensation available to them under Maryland’s contributory negligence doctrine, which bars recovery if the plaintiff is found even slightly at fault.

Can I still receive compensation if I was partially at fault for the bicycle accident?

Maryland operates under a strict contributory negligence rule, which means that if you are found to be even 1% at fault for the accident, you may be barred from receiving any compensation for your injuries. What should I do immediately after a bicycle accident in Silver Spring, MD?

Immediately after a bicycle accident in Silver Spring, MD, it’s crucial to prioritize your safety and health. If able, move to a safe area away from traffic, and call 911 to report the accident and request medical assistance if needed. Gather information from any involved parties, such as names, contact details, and insurance information, and take photos of the accident scene, your injuries, and any damages to your bicycle. Additionally, seek medical attention as soon as possible, even if you believe your injuries are minor, as some symptoms may appear delayed. How long do I have to file a bicycle accident lawsuit in Silver Spring, MD?

In Silver Spring, MD, the statute of limitations for filing a personal injury lawsuit, including those arising from bicycle accidents, is generally three years from the date of the accident. This timeframe is critical as failing to file within this period typically results in the loss of your right to seek compensation for your injuries and damages. 6 Tips To Ensure Safe Group Riding

Cycling in groups can be an enjoyable and rewarding experience, but it’s important to prioritize safety to avoid accidents and injuries. Here are some essential tips for cyclists participating in group rides according to our Silver Spring, MD bicycle accident lawyer:

  1. Communicate: Effective communication is key to safe group riding. Use hand signals, verbal cues, and eye contact to communicate with other riders about changes in speed, direction, and road hazards. Clear communication helps to keep the group together and avoid collisions. Be sure to discuss what every signal means before setting out on your ride so everyone is on the same page.
  2. Stay Predictable: Maintain a steady pace and ride predictably within the group. Avoid sudden movements, erratic behavior, or abrupt changes in direction that can catch other riders off guard and lead to accidents. Consistency is key to maintaining a smooth and safe group ride.
  3. Follow The Leader: Designate a lead rider or ride captain to set the pace and guide the group. Follow the leader’s cues and signals, and avoid passing or overtaking without clear communication and consent. Respect the authority of the lead rider to maintain order and safety within the group.
  4. Mind The Gap: Maintain a safe distance between yourself and other riders to prevent collisions and allow for sudden stops or changes in direction. Leave enough space to react to unexpected obstacles or hazards on the road. As a general rule, maintain at least a bike length of distance between riders.
  5. Watch For Hazards: Stay vigilant and watch for potential hazards on the road, such as potholes, gravel, debris, or road obstacles. Signal hazards to other riders and communicate effectively to ensure the safety of the group. Avoid sudden swerving or braking to minimize the risk of accidents. Work on a plan ahead of time in case there is a hazard so that everyone knows what to do in case of emergency.
  6. Be Visible: Ensure that you are visible to other road users, especially in low-light conditions or inclement weather. Use front and rear lights, reflective gear, and bright clothing to increase your visibility and reduce the risk of accidents. Make yourself easy to see and anticipate by other road users. Make sure that the entire group is visible and not just a few members so that everyone is safe; you can coordinate this with matching reflective gear or the same lights to install on bikes.

Group riding can be a fun and social experience, but safety should always be the top priority.
